Appearance

Arc wears a very dusty kilt with a thin leather belt to keep it hanging at his waist. Along with cloth wrappings around his hands and wrists, he usually wears no shirt as he prefers to show off his muscles.

Personality

Arc'kek is a carefree guy with a hind of overconfidence in his actions, but still is nice towards those he meets. Arc'kek is quick to rile up and can be emotional at times. He's also inclined to start conversations, as he hates the silence that can overcome any situation, he is quite the talker, but knows when to shut up. He is also a determined individual, never stepping off a journey until it is finished and he is fiercely loyal to those he trusts with his life. As to the ladies, although being raised differently, he admires their everlasting beauty and can be categorized as quite the womanizer. Under all of that, Arc'kek thinks more than anything, juding the right from wrong and so on. Yet, that doesn't stop him from doing brash things. Overall to people, he means to look like that guy you can talk to about anything and have a good time with.

History

Arc'kek Ul'naka was born on the Darkspear Island before Thrall's exodus from Lordaeron took place. The murlocs were docile at this time and Arc'kek grew with the seemingly everlasting peace of the Darkspear Island. Arc'kek was born into a hunters family, his life was to find food for his family and the tribe's overall being. Arc'kek was an overall poor hunter in the beginning, due to the fact that he would rather admire the nature of the animal than actually use it's carcass as food. Yet, he learned and grew from his mistakes, become a stalwart hunter over his younger years. At this time, Arc'kek started to take an interest into the powers and practices of the tribe's Witch Doctors, often times he would watch them invoke the spirits of their potions and use them to cure and defend their homes. Arc'kek wanted to learn the Witch Doctor's art and so he became an apprentice of a Witch Doctor named Ulna. Starting his apprenticeship, Arc'kek found himself lacking in the potions department of the Wtich Doctor, only able to make minor curing potions, but he took an increasing interest into the Loa of the potions, seeing the spirits of the potions brought to life and used in the physical world. Over time, Ulna became a close person to Arc'kek and more than often, the two would spend days at a time together.

Arc'kek's apprenticeship would end though, when the once docile murlocs rose up and started to worship the ill naga, known as the Sea Witch. The murlocs were entangled with the tribe often times and battles broke out in mere moments of existance, Arc'kek wanted to fight, but his family denied it, claiming that he would be the only one left to take care of his family. Arc'kek grew furious at this, although, he knew they were right, if his father died, he would be the only one left to take care of his family. Soon, after the first attacks by the murlocs, his father ended up missing and later was found to be dead. Arc'kek grieved over this and took up his fathers roll in his family, abandoning his Witch Doctor apprenticeship. Ulna frowned at this action, for he wanted Arc'kek to continue on his path, not become something he didn't want. For that, Unla started to enter the fray. Hoping to end this war soon, so Arc'kek might have a chance at becoming a Witch Doctor. Arc'kek was left with his family, while those he kept close went to war, to do nothing, but die.

The Darkspear Tribe's fate seemed sealed until Thrall and his Orcs soon washed up on the shores of the Darkspear Island. Seeking shelter on the island. Sen'jin took the orcs in and they started to get along well, with each other. With renewed hope, they began to fight against the murlocs well. Arc'kek was glad for Thrall's arrival, giving him a new perspective on this war, maybe they would win, maybe Ulna would come back to the village. Yet, with that renewed hope, came disaster, Thrall and Sen'jin, along with several other trolls and orcs, were captured by the Sea Witch and her murlocs. Arc'kek wouldn't stand for the leader of their tribe being captured, he took up the spear and went out to fight the murlocs as best he could. Time passed and Arc'kek kept up the fight until Thrall and his orcs came back, Sen'jin was not with them. With the dying wishes of Sen'jin for Thrall to save the trolls from this island, Vol'jin took up the mantle of the leader and agreed to sail with Thrall and make a new home in Durotar. Arc'kek followed as well, not wishing to remain on this dreaded island any longer... Yet, Ulna never came back, this bothered Arc'kek a great deal.

Upon the arrival to Durotar, and the eventual outbreak of the Third War, Arc'kek did little with the outside world, taking care of who remained in his family, on the Echo Isles. He lived the normal life, hunting for food, trying to find a mate, etc.. Arc'kek's mind returned to the world outside, far from the Echo Isles or even Durotar. He wondered what had become of Ulna and wondered what would have happened if he kept his path down that of the Witch Doctor. After the defeat of Admiral Proudmoore, Arc'kek grew more interested in leaving the Echo Isles, his sister, Jen'ro, was old enough to care for the family and he started to prepare to leave the Echo Isles. That was until, the betrayal of Zalazane and the eventual pushing of the trolls back to Sen'jin Village. His family had been taken by Zalzane's mind control and Arc'kek believed that he was alone...

He left the village, and perused to find the Loa arts, taking back his old path on Darkspear Island. In all that time, he's never once returned to the Echo Isles or Sen'jin Village, still believing that his family was lost to the mind control of Zalazane.
